Best Time of Year for Family Photos at Lost Dutchman State Park
Arizona is beautiful year-round, but desert sessions are most comfortable from October through April. The cooler temperatures make evening sessions enjoyable, especially for little ones.
Winter sunsets in the desert are particularly stunning — soft, golden, and flattering. Summer sessions are still possible, but I recommend sunrise sessions to avoid the intense afternoon heat.
Planning your session during Arizona’s milder months ensures everyone stays comfortable and relaxed — and that always translates beautifully in your photos.
What to Wear for Desert Family Photos
Styling plays such an important role in creating cohesive, timeless images.
For desert sessions, I recommend:
- Neutral tones like cream, tan, warm, muted blue, sage, and rust
- Avoiding neon colors or busy patterns
- Flowy dresses that move beautifully in the desert breeze
- Layering with cardigans or denim jackets for texture
- Closed-toe shoes for comfort on desert terrain
The goal is coordination, not matching — and choosing colors that complement the desert landscape will elevate your entire gallery.
